New Band Stand, Oak Hill Park

This fine shell type bandstand was opened in 1929, and two bands occupied the platform on the occasion
the photo was taken.
It faces almost due south, at the bottom of the slope leading to the War Memorial, a great number of people can see the band from this point, and the sound is uninterrupted by the sloping roof, which acts as a sounding board. Of ornamental design, it is a fine acquisition to the Park, and will serve for high class, as well as local bands, expert authority has been sought for this site and design
